Brandon Banks, Cody Fajardo and Dane Evans named Shaw CFL Top Performers

TORONTO (October 29, 2019) – Brandon Banks, Cody Fajardo and Dane Evans were named the Shaw CFL Top Performers of the Week for Week 20 of the CFL’s 2019 season.

The three players were chosen by a panel of judges comprised of former CFL players Matt Dunigan and Duane Forde, as well as, Pierre Vercheval of RDS, who independently send their selections to the CFL head office.

WR | BRANDON BANKS | HAMILTON TIGER-CATS

Hamilton star receiver Brandon Banks tallied a personal-best 201 receiving yards on 11 receptions and three touchdowns to lead the team to a 38-26 road victory.

Late in the opening quarter, Dane Evans connected with Banks over the middle, who then proceeded to weave his way in for the 55-yard major. The reception – Banks’ fourth of the day – also broke Luke Tasker’s team record for catches in a single season (104).

Evans found Banks at the back of the endzone for a nine-yard score to give the visitors a 27-21 advantage midway through the third in the seesaw affair. After Montreal drew within two points early in the final frame, Evans’ shovel pass to Banks resulted in a six-yard score to cap the Garner, N.C., native’s big day.

Banks leads the league in receptions (112), receiving yards (1,550) and receiving touchdowns (13). He was previously named a Shaw CFL Top Performer in Weeks 5 and 9, in addition to a monthly nod in June.

QB | CODY FAJARDO | SASKATCHEWAN ROUGHRIDERS

Cody Fajardo completed 25-of-35 passes for 429 yards and two touchdowns in a 27-24 victory over Edmonton. The win moved the Roughriders into first in the West Division with one week remaining.

The Nevada product recorded his 17th passing touchdown of the campaign midway through the third quarter, finding Kyran Moore for a 25-yard major, which trimmed the Esks’ lead to 17-13.

On the next possession, Fajardo marched the Roughriders down the field on a six-play, 74-yard drive before connecting with Emmanuel Arceneaux on a five-yard touchdown pass. With the game knotted at 24 and overtime looming, Fajardo completed 5-of-7 passes en route to a nine-play, 69-yard drive to set up Brett Lauther’s game-winning field goal.

Fajardo owns a 71.5 completion rate and tops the CFL in passing yards (4,302), while notching 28 touchdowns (18 passing, 10 rushing). This is the Brea, Calif., native’s fourth weekly recognition following selections in Weeks 3, 8 and 16.

QB | DANE EVANS | HAMILTON TIGER-CATS

Hamilton quarterback Dane Evans continues to power the 2019 edition of the Tiger-Cats to new heights, adding another victory on top of the team’s franchise mark of 13 set in Week 19.

Evans was 29-for-36 (80.6%), throwing for 379 yards and a career-high four touchdowns in Hamilton’s 38-26 victory over Montreal. Brandon Banks was Evans’ preferred target on the day, accounting for 201 passing yards and a trio of majors. The Sanger, Texas, native’s remaining TD pass – a 6-yard strike to Anthony Coombs in the third quarter – and the ensuing convert tied the game at 21-a-piece.

The Tulsa product has passed for 300+ yards on seven occasions this season, including six times in Hamilton’s past seven games. Evans has accumulated 3,754 passing yards and 24 touchdowns (21 pass, 3 rush), while completing 72.2% of his attempts.

Evans has now been selected among the week’s best on four occasions (Weeks 12, 16, 19 and 20), in addition to being named a Shaw CFL Top Performer of the Month in September.

About the Canadian Football League

Built on a foundation of more than 110 years of football tradition and history, the Canadian Football League features nine teams, millions of fans and a commitment to service to the community, as well as, elite sport. To stay up to date with CFL news, visit CFL.ca.
